This groundbreaking collaboration aims to enhance network capabilities, paving the way for innovative services across various sectors in Indonesia.
The MoU outlines a strategic plan for Indosat to integrate Nokia's 5G Cloud RAN solution with Nvidia’s AI Aerial platform, creating a unified accelerated computing infrastructure dedicated to hosting both AI and RAN workloads. The partnership will initially focus on bringing AI inferencing workloads to the Nvidia AI Aerial platform, followed by the seamless integration of RAN workloads, ensuring a robust and efficient network environment.
Indosat highlighted that the deployment of AI-RAN will not only lead to significant improvements in network performance, spectral efficiency, and energy consumption but will also position the company for a transition towards future 6G capabilities.
“AI-RAN will enable Indosat to share infrastructure costs across multiple applications, maximizing its return on investment while unlocking new revenue streams via AI-driven services. When you combine AI with RAN, you create an engine for future innovation. With our 5G Cloud RAN platform, Indosat can transform its network into a multi-purpose computing grid leveraging the synergies of AI-accelerated computing,” said Tommi Uitto, President of Mobile Networks at Nokia.
A 5G AI-RAN lab will be established in Surabaya in early 2025 for joint development, testing, and validation. Indosat plans to launch a small-scale commercial pilot for AI Inferencing workloads on the Nvidia AI-RAN infrastructure in the second half of this year, with broader deployment scheduled for 2026.
“This initiative makes us the first operator in Southeast Asia and the third globally to build a commercial AI-RAN network. By embedding AI into our radio access network, we’re not just enhancing connectivity — we’re building a nationwide AI-powered ecosystem that will fuel innovation across industries,” said Vikram Sinha, President Director and CEO of Indosat.
In addition, Indosat, Nokia, and Nvidia will collaborate with Indonesian universities and research institutions to promote AI-RAN development. They will support academic programs aimed at fostering AI innovation in telecom applications, thereby accelerating breakthroughs in AI-driven network optimization, spectral efficiency, and energy consumption.
